Top job projections for graduates in trade and industrial teacher education from indiana university of pennsylvania - main campus

Career/technical education teachers, secondary school

Projection Rating: B

Median Annual Wage: $65,130

Percentage of Paycheck to Repay: 14.64%-10.90%

Employment Change: -0.7%

Entry-Level Education: Bachelor's degree

Career/technical education teachers, middle school

Projection Rating: B

Median Annual Wage: $63,860

Percentage of Paycheck to Repay: 14.93%-11.11%

Employment Change: -0.1%

Entry-Level Education: Bachelor's degree
